WebThings to do in Cheddar, Somerset - Visitors to the village of Cheddar and Cheddar Gorge have been astounded by Cheddar’s magnificent limestone Gorge for centuries. Cheddar Gorge can be viewed from the public road running through the ravine or by footpaths along the top of the cliffs where you can drink in spectacular 360° views of the Mendip Hills.
